unix FTPS cURL目录创建失败

时间:2015-06-12 16:38:47

标签: linux unix curl ftps

我想在FTPS上创建一个文件夹,然后将文件上传到新创建的文件夹中。请有人帮帮我吗?

下面是我正在使用的截断脚本

ftp_resp =`#lftp<
                         curl <<EOF --ftp-create-dirs  & ${ordernumber} & -T "${l_source_folder_v}/Write/$base_name" & -v -k --ftp-ssl-reqd ftp://ftps.mydomain.com -u $l_username_v:$l_password_v; 

            #set net:timeout 10; set net:max-retries 3; set net:reconnect-interval-base 5; set net:reconnect-interval-multiplier 1;set ftps:initial-prot "";  set ftp:ssl-force true;  set ftp:ssl-protect-data true;
            #put ${l_source_folder_v}/Write/$base_name;
            #bye

EOF`

我的问题是在脚本中创建文件夹然后随后上传文件的位置。

谢谢!

1 个答案:

答案 0 :(得分:0)

我找到了一种方法来创建目录并通过以下代码将文件上传到这个新创建的目录中

curl -v -k --ftp-create-dirs --ftp-ssl-reqd ftp://ftps.mydomain.com/yourfoldername/ -u $l_username_v:$l_password_v -T "path_of_the_file/newfile.txt";